Building and Maintaining Trust in Affiliate Marketing
Trust is the cornerstone of successful affiliate program marketing. Building and maintaining trust with your audience is essential for long-term success. This guide will explore strategies to enhance credibility and foster trust in your affiliate marketing efforts.
1. Transparency
Being transparent with your audience is critical:
- Disclosure: Clearly disclose your affiliate relationships to your audience. Transparency builds trust and is also a legal requirement in many regions.
- Honest Reviews: Offer genuine, balanced reviews of products. Highlight both the pros and cons to provide real value to your readers.
- Open Communication: Keep your communication channels open and be responsive to queries and feedback.
2. Quality Content
Quality content is vital for establishing authority and trust:
- Informative and Helpful: Create content that genuinely helps your audience solve problems or make informed decisions.
- Well-Researched: Ensure all information is accurate, up-to-date, and well-supported by reputable sources.
- Professional Presentation: Ensure your content is well-written and professionally presented. Poor grammar or sloppy formatting can undermine credibility.
3. Consistent Branding
Consistent branding helps reinforce your identity and trustworthiness:
- Brand Voice: Maintain a consistent tone and style that resonates with your audience and reflects your brand values.
- Visual Identity: Use a consistent visual style across all platforms, from your website to your social media profiles.
- Reliable Experience: Ensure that your website and social media platforms are reliable and easy to use.
4. Ethical Marketing Practices
Adopt ethical marketing practices to enhance trust:
- Avoid Spammy Tactics: Steer clear of overly aggressive or deceptive marketing tactics.
- Respect Privacy: Respect your audience’s privacy by adhering to data protection laws and clearly explaining how their data will be used.
- Fair Advertising: Ensure that all advertising is fair and not misleading.
5. Engage with Your Community
Engaging with your community shows that you value their input and care about their experiences:
- Active Participation: Actively participate in discussions related to your niche, both on your platforms and elsewhere online.
- Support and Help: Offer support and assistance when needed. Be seen as a helpful resource rather than just a salesperson.
- Feedback Incorporation: Show that you listen to feedback by incorporating suggestions and addressing concerns in your content and strategies.
Conclusion
Building and maintaining trust is crucial in affiliate program marketing. By being transparent, producing quality content, maintaining consistent branding, practicing ethical marketing, and engaging with your community, you can establish a strong, trustworthy relationship with your audience.
